Abstract | The saga of the search for the ultimate constituents of matter has long been one of finding a seemingly fundamental structure that, in turn, was found to be made of even smaller building blocks. Matter is made of molecules. Molecules are in turn made of atoms, which are themselves made of electrons and atomic nuclei. The nucleus consists of protons and neutrons, and these nucleons are composed of quarks. The author discusses this search and concludes with a reflection that the mystery of quark and lepton generations and the question of substructure is a real one and one without any known answer. Unlike the Higgs mechanism or supersymmetry, this conundrum does not have an established and popular prospective solution. (ERIC). |
